#include "kstatusbar.h"
#include <QtCore/QHash>
#include <QtCore/QEvent>
#include <QtGui/QLabel>
#include <kdebug.h>
#include <kglobal.h>
#include <ksharedconfig.h>
#include <kconfiggroup.h>
#include "ksqueezedtextlabel.h"
class KStatusBarPrivate
{
public:
int id(QObject* object) const
{
QHash<int, QLabel*>::const_iterator it = qFind(items, object);
if (it != items.constEnd())
return it.key();
// Not found. This happens when a subclass uses an eventFilter too,
// on objects not registered here.
return -1;
}
QHash<int, QLabel*> items;
};
bool KStatusBar::eventFilter(QObject* object, QEvent* event)
{
if ( event->type() == QEvent::MouseButtonPress ) {
const int id = d->id(object);
if (id > -1) {
emit pressed( d->id( object ) );
return true;
}
}
else if ( event->type() == QEvent::MouseButtonRelease ) {
const int id = d->id(object);
if (id > -1) {
emit released( d->id( object ) );
return true;
}
}
return QStatusBar::eventFilter(object, event);
}
KStatusBar::KStatusBar( QWidget *parent )
: QStatusBar( parent ),
d(new KStatusBarPrivate)
{
// make the size grip stuff configurable
// ...but off by default (sven)
// ...but on by default on OSX, else windows with a KStatusBar are not resizable at all (marijn)
KSharedConfig::Ptr config = KGlobal::config();
KConfigGroup group( config, QLatin1String("StatusBar style") );
bool grip_enabled = group.readEntry(QLatin1String("SizeGripEnabled"), false);
setSizeGripEnabled(grip_enabled);
}
KStatusBar::~KStatusBar ()
{
delete d;
}
void KStatusBar::insertItem( const QString& text, int id, int stretch)
{
if ( d->items[id] ) {
kDebug() << "KStatusBar::insertItem: item id " << id << " already exists.";
}
KSqueezedTextLabel *l = new KSqueezedTextLabel( text, this );
l->installEventFilter( this );
l->setFixedHeight( fontMetrics().height() + 2 );
l->setAlignment( Qt::AlignHCenter | Qt::AlignVCenter );
d->items.insert( id, l );
addPermanentWidget( l, stretch );
l->show();
}
void KStatusBar::insertFixedItem( const QString& text, int id )
{
insertItem( text, id, 0 );
setItemFixed( id );
}
void KStatusBar::insertPermanentItem( const QString& text, int id, int stretch)
{
if (d->items[id]) {
kDebug() << "KStatusBar::insertPermanentItem: item id " << id << " already exists.";
}
QLabel *l = new QLabel( text, this );
l->installEventFilter( this );
l->setFixedHeight( fontMetrics().height() + 2 );
l->setAlignment( Qt::AlignHCenter | Qt::AlignVCenter );
d->items.insert( id, l );
addPermanentWidget( l, stretch );
l->show();
}
void KStatusBar::insertPermanentFixedItem( const QString& text, int id )
{
insertPermanentItem( text, id, 0 );
setItemFixed( id );
}
void KStatusBar::removeItem (int id)
{
if ( d->items.contains( id ) ) {
QLabel *label = d->items[id];
removeWidget( label );
d->items.remove( id );
delete label;
} else {
kDebug() << "KStatusBar::removeItem: bad item id: " << id;
}
}
bool KStatusBar::hasItem( int id ) const
{
return d->items.contains(id);
}
QString KStatusBar::itemText( int id ) const
{
if ( !hasItem( id ) ) {
return QString();
}
return d->items[id]->text();
}
void KStatusBar::changeItem( const QString& text, int id )
{
QLabel *label = d->items[id];
KSqueezedTextLabel *squeezed = qobject_cast<KSqueezedTextLabel*>( label );
if ( squeezed ) {
squeezed->setText( text );
} else if ( label ) {
label->setText( text );
if ( label->minimumWidth () != label->maximumWidth () ) {
reformat();
}
} else {
kDebug() << "KStatusBar::changeItem: bad item id: " << id;
}
}
void KStatusBar::setItemAlignment (int id, Qt::Alignment alignment)
{
QLabel *label = qobject_cast<QLabel*>( d->items[id] );
if ( label ) {
label->setAlignment( alignment );
} else {
kDebug() << "KStatusBar::setItemAlignment: bad item id: " << id;
}
}
void KStatusBar::setItemFixed(int id, int w)
{
QLabel *label = qobject_cast<QLabel*>(d->items[id]);
if ( label ) {
if ( w == -1 ) {
w = fontMetrics().boundingRect(label->text()).width()+3;
}
label->setFixedWidth(w);
} else {
kDebug() << "KStatusBar::setItemFixed: bad item id: " << id;
}
}
#include "moc_kstatusbar.cpp"
